The hinges are misaligned

A misaligned hinge is a problem that affects the function and aesthetic of your doors. They can cause friction between the door and frame which can cause squeaking and creaking. The hinges can also become loose from normal wear and tear, corrosion or when the door is constantly slammed. In this scenario it is crucial to fix the issue immediately.

In most cases, door hinges are corrected by adjusting a screw on the hinge. If the knuckles of the hinge are bent, they'll require to be welded or replaced. In addition, if the hinges on your door are loose it could be necessary to put in new screws that are longer than the ones that are currently used.

Remain in the back and examine your hinges to identify the reason. Look for gaps around the edges of the door and the hinges themselves. If the gap is bigger on one side than the other, this means that the door is not in alignment with its frame and will require shimming to correct the issue.

The hinges may also be too loose and cause the door to snag when it is closed and opened. You can fix this by tightening hinge screws with the screwdriver or drill. If the hinges have stripped threads and are loose and sagging, you can replace them with screws that are longer.

Over time, as a house moves and settles, the strike plate on the door may expand and move out of alignment with the jamb. You can either sand the part that is rubbing the jamb, or move the strike plate.

The most common problem with doors that are not aligned is because hinges are loose. This could be due to loose hinge screws, corroded or stripped anchor plates or a lack of proper installation when the door was initially installed. To correct the problem you must tighten the screws and ensure whether the anchor plates have been installed correctly. If the door is not aligned, try relocating the hinges drilling holes in the new location and then plugging the old ones.

Locks that aren't working

A door lock that isn't working as it should could create a security risk. It could be that the latch or bolt isn't striking the strike plate properly and your home is at risk to burglars who are able to jimmy open the door. It could also be that the cylinder has a fault. If this is the cause you can determine by how the deadbolt extends into the door hole. If the deadbolt isn't able to extend completely or makes an extremely loud sound when it is turned, it is most likely that the cylinder is broken.

In some instances an issue with the lock can be fixed by lubricating it using the correct oil. This will prevent the lock from becoming stuck or frozen. If you've tried this method and the issue persists it could be time to call a professional.

A door lock can become stiff due to dirt and grime. You can clean this grime using the help of a toothbrush or cotton swabs that are placed into the keyhole. However, you may need to disassemble the lock to access specific parts. After cleaning the lock, you can re-establish its function by applying a substantial amount of the lubricant. It is important to use a dry lubricant, such as graphite spray, instead of wet lubricants such as WD-40, as these are more likely to harm the internal components of the lock.
